The air intake duct is what causes this vibration about 99% of the time. You will notice it when at low rpm and a slight to heavy load on the engine. Also it gives the illusion of coming from the passenger side dash/a-pillar. At my dealership we have replaced and insulated the duct on just about every impreza we service.

Problem: rattle from front right engine compartment when the engine is bogged down between 3rd and 4th gear.

Solution: Approx 1" thick foam strip sliced from a gardening kneeling pad and jammed into air vent junction.

Problem solved, no more rattle.
